A. A coach doesn't replace a QB because the backup looked good on a couple of drives against an outmatched opponent.

B. The coach needs two QB's ready to play. If he moves the backup to the starting role, he risks the starter leaving the team and entering the transfer portal, then he is an injury away from having to play an unready guy.

C. Making such a move too quickly risks causing a split in the locker room. A divided locker room is a major problem.
